The Mississippi Medical Cannabis Act requires that a medical cannabis establishment, inclusive of a cannabis transportation entity, shall not be within 1,000 feet of the nearest property boundary line of a school, church or child care facility which exists or has acquired necessary real property for the operation of such facility before the date of the medical cannabis establishment application unless the entity has received approval from the school, church or child care facility and received the applicable waiver from their licensing agency, provided that the main point of entry of the cannabis establishment is not located within five hundred (500) feet of the nearest property boundary line of any school, church or child care facility. The Agriculture Improvement Act of 2018 (the 2018 Farm Bill) was approved in June 2018, and Mississippi adopted it in 2020; however, at the time, there were about 275 licensed hemp farmers but none of them were actively cultivating hemp, says Melanie Sorenson, MIHA executive director.
